Sever's Disease
kidshealth.org — “Sever's disease, a common heel injury in kids, is due to inflammation (swelling) of the growth plate in the heel. While painful, it's only temporary and has no long-term effects.” View full resource at kidshealth.org

Esophagitis: eMedicine Gastroenterology
emedicine.medscape.com — “Overview: The most common cause of esophagitis is gastroesophageal reflux disease (GERD). Other important, but less common, causes are infections, medications, radiation therapy, systemic disease, and trauma. Eosinophilic esophagitis has emerged as an important cause of esophagitis ...” View full resource at emedicine.medscape.com
